Cheapest Bunk Beds For Sale

If you're on a budget but still want to improve storage in the bedroom of your kids then a bunk bed is the way to go. Designed with security in mind, these beds can accommodate guests as well as children.

There are many choices to choose from, but the most important thing is to be sure you're buying a high-quality product that will last.

Wayfair

Wayfair offers a vast selection of bunk beds that meet a variety of different requirements and space limitations. There's something here to suit everyone, from simple designs that provide ample sleeping space to bunk beds with slide and playhouses.

When you are choosing a bed for your children, you should be aware of the dimensions of your bedroom and the number of kids you'll be accommodating. You'll need the size of each bed, regardless of whether it's for a room shared with two siblings or dorm style.

Find bunk beds with shelves and drawers if you need more storage. These allow your children to keep their clothing and other essentials within reach when they're not in bed.

It's also important to consider the security of every bunk bed you buy. A lot of bunk beds come with guardrails that are full length to prevent accidents from falling, particularly for children who are small. The recommended mattress's height is another important factor to consider.

Oeuf

Oeuf (pronounced ohf) is a contemporary style that combines the best of responsible sourcing with Michael Ryan and Sophie Demenge. Their range of furniture for juniors and nursery rooms is chic, elevated and whimsical. Oeuf provides everything from bunks to cribs to dressers, bookcases and toys.

By using sustainable woods They take care to incorporate eco-friendly materials into their designs. Their wood is responsibly sourced in Europe from forests, and then finished with non-toxic finishings that are free of harmful VOCs and chemicals.

The Perch Bunk Bed from Oeuf is the ideal centerpiece for any room with a child and its sleek lines and low height make it accessible for small hands. Its ladder with an angled design has a safety tread that helps ensure your children's safety while they climb the steps.

This is an excellent option for a shared space and its various configuration options will satisfy the requirements of your children. Set it up as a traditional bunk or make use of the top bunk create an impressive loft with storage beneath. You could also use the lower bunk to create a lowline mattress, which could provide additional storage space for your children.

Maisonette

It is no secret that bunk beds are a great way to reduce the size of your home especially if you have kids. These beds can also let older children share an area with their friends or family members who don't require an entire mattress.

The downside to bunk beds is that it can be a real hassle to clean. Your child could bring food wrappers, toys and action figures up on the top bunk, which could create a mess to keep clean and tidy.

It's important to take your time when looking for bunk beds. You'll want safety features such as side rails that don't have more than 15 inch gaps at either end, and 3.5 inches between them. Also, it's best to choose a model with integrated stairs instead of an individual ladder.

Another option is to purchase one with built-in stairs rather than an actual ladder, which could make it easier for your child to climb up to the top bunk. This is especially beneficial for rooms with a ceiling that is low in your child's bedroom, since it allows them to leave and return from the lower bunk without sacrificing the floor space by one foot.
